Key facts

Checked bag
One bag up to 20 kilogramsApplies to the researched BKK–Pattaya coach service.
Personal item
One small personal bagIncluded alongside the supported checked-bag allowance.

The checked allowance has two parts

For the researched BKK–Pattaya coach service, Airports of Thailand and the operator FAQ support one checked bag up to 20 kilograms plus one small personal item. Both the checked-bag limit and the separate personal item belong to the supported rule.

Keep the item count and weight together when reading the allowance. “Up to 20 kilograms” does not remove the one-checked-bag part of the statement.

Keep the rule attached to this coach service

The evidence is specific to the checked Suvarnabhumi–Pattaya coach. It does not establish the baggage policy for a different coach operator, train, taxi, ride-hailing trip or private transfer.

Confirm the selected service before applying the allowance. A general “bus to Pattaya” label is not enough to transfer one operator’s rule to another product.
